Hennessey Tells The Story Of Its Epic 265mph Venom GT Spyder Speed Run

Last month, the Hennessey Venom GT Spyder became the 'world's fastest convertible' after hitting a massive 265.6mph. This video takes a behind-the-scenes look at what went into the incredible top speed run

This bonkers top speed run is yet to be recognised by Guinness as an ‘official’ world record and most likely won’t ever be. Like the previous speed ‘record’ clocked by the coupe Venom GT, the Spyder’s effort won’t be considered by the organisation as not enough of the cars have been made for it to qualify as a production vehicle.

Official or not though, I’m sure we’ll all agree 265.6mph in a car without a roof is a stunning achievement.
